More like a BMW to a Pinto. Bose aren't too respected around HTF due to the price they charge for relatively inexpensive speaker materials and the fact that they are incapable of truely giving off high and low frequency sounds. Many also feel their advertising is highly misleading and aimed at relatively naive consumers. That said, B & W speakers and Marantz receivers enjoy great reputations as fine audio equipment. I can't help you with the prices, but rest assured that you got some pretty decent gear there. B&W is a well-respected British loudspeaker manufacturer, and their CDM-NT line is just 1 step below their flagship Nautilus line, with several key technologies integrated. Marantz electronics are also pretty well regarded, especially their receivers, CD players and SACD players. I'm not too sure about their DVD players though.
